At your request, Huddleston-Berry Engineering & Testing, LLC completed design of an Onsite
Wastewater Treatment System (OWTS) for a single-family residence at Parcel 212728100382 in
Garfield County, Colorado. The site location is shown on Figure I - Site Location Map. A site
plan is included as Figure 2.
Site Conditions
At the time of the investigation, the site was open and undulating. Site topography is shown on
Figure 2. Yegetation consisted primarily of weeds, grasses, and small to large bushes and trees.
The site was bordered to the north and west by open land, and to the east and south by vacant
lots.
Subsurface InvestÍsation
As indicated on in the referenced report, the subsurface conditions at the site were fairly
consistent. The test pits encountered 1.0 foot of topsoil above tan, moist, stiff sandy lean clay
with gravel, cobble, and boulder soils to the bottoms of the excavations. Groundwater was not
encountered in the subsurface at the time of the investigation. Based upon the results of the
subsurface investigation, HBET believes that the seasonal high groundwater elevation is deeper
than 8.0 feet at this site.
The locations of the test pits are shown on Figure 2. Copies of the test pit logs are included in
Appendix A.

Seepøge ßed Desígn
The design of the absorption system generally follows the requirements of the Garfield County
Department of Public Works as outlined in the Garfield County On-Site Wostewater Treatment
System Regulations, effective June 2018. The proposed construction at the site is anticipated to
include a five-bedroom home.
Based upon visual-tactile classification of the site soils, a Long-Term Acceptance Rate (LTAR)
of 0.5 will be utilized for the absorption field design. Infiltrator Systems Quick4 Standard
Chambers are proposed. The daily flow of the sewage disposal system is calculated below, and a
plan and profile of the absorption system are shown on Figure 3.
Average Daily Flow: (8 persons)(75 GPD/person)
:450 GPD
Soil Treatment Area: (600 GPD / 0.5): 1,200 Square Feet
Adjusted Soil Treatment Area : (1,200 SFXI.2X0.7) : 1,008 Square Feet
# of Quick4 Chambers : (1,008 I 12¡ :84 Chambers
System Instøllotíon
The installation of the septic tank, plumbing lines, Infiltrators, etc. should be completed in
accordance with the Garfield County On-Site Wastewater Treatment System Regulotions and
Infiltrator Systems, Inc. specifications. In addition, the following construction procedures are
recommended:. The septic tank and distribution box should be placed level over native soils that have
been scarified to a depth of I to 12 inches, moisture conditioned, and recompacted to
a minimum of 95o/o of the standard Proctor maximum dry density, within *2%o of
optimum moisture content. However, up to 3-inches of washed rock or pipe bedding
passing the l-inch sieve may be used as a leveling course under the septic tank and/or
distribution box.. The bottoms of trenches and backfill around the septic tank and distribution box
which will support sewer or effluent lines should be compacted to at least 90 percent
of the standard Proctor maximum dry density, within *ZYo of optimum moisture
content. Pipe bedding should have a maximum particle size of l-inch.. Vehicular or heavy equipment traffic and placement of structures should not encroach
within l0 feet of the septic tank or distribution box.
Inspectíon Schedule
Huddleston-Berry Engineering & Testing LLC should be retained to monitor the construction of
the OWTS. The following schedule of observation and/or testing should be followed:. Observe the absorption bed excavation prior to placement of Infiltrator chambers.. Observe placement of the septic tank, distribution box, and all connecting sewer and
effluent lines prior to backfill. Veriff proper fall between inverts.r Observe and verifu installation of the absorption bed prior to placement of cover and
backfill.
